    Food products are classified into 4 groups according to their degree of processing:

    1. Unprocessed or minimally processed foods
    2. Processed culinary ingredients
    3. Processed foods
    4. Ultra processed foods

    The determination of the group is based on the category of the product and on the ingredients it contains.

  • E202 - Potassium sorbate


    Potassium sorbate (E202) is a synthetic food preservative commonly used to extend the shelf life of various food products.

    It works by inhibiting the growth of molds, yeast, and some bacteria, preventing spoilage. When added to foods, it helps maintain their freshness and quality.

    Some studies have shown that when combined with nitrites, potassium sorbate have genotoxic activity in vitro. However, potassium sorbate is generally recognized as safe (GRAS) by regulatory authorities.

  • E310 - Propyl gallate


    Propyl gallate: Propyl gallate, or propyl 3‚4,5-trihydroxybenzoate is an ester formed by the condensation of gallic acid and propanol. Since 1948, this antioxidant has been added to foods containing oils and fats to prevent oxidation. As a food additive, it is used under the E number E310.

  • E321 - Butylated hydroxytoluene


    Butylated hydroxytoluene: Butylated hydroxytoluene -BHT-, also known as dibutylhydroxytoluene, is a lipophilic organic compound, chemically a derivative of phenol, that is useful for its antioxidant properties. European and U.S. regulations allow small amounts to be used as a food additive. In addition to this use, BHT is widely used to prevent oxidation in fluids -e.g. fuel, oil- and other materials where free radicals must be controlled.

  • E450 - Diphosphates


    Diphosphates (E450) are food additives often utilized to modify the texture of products, acting as leavening agents in baking and preventing the coagulation of canned food.

    These salts can stabilize whipped cream and are also found in powdered products to maintain their flow properties. They are commonly present in baked goods, processed meats, and soft drinks.

    Derived from phosphoric acid, they're part of our daily phosphate intake, which often surpasses recommended levels due to the prevalence of phosphates in processed foods and drinks.

    Excessive phosphate consumption is linked to health issues, such as impaired kidney function and weakened bone health. Though diphosphates are generally regarded as safe when consumed within established acceptable daily intakes, it's imperative to monitor overall phosphate consumption to maintain optimal health.

  • E500 - Sodium carbonates


    Sodium carbonates (E500) are compounds commonly used in food preparation as leavening agents, helping baked goods rise by releasing carbon dioxide when they interact with acids.

    Often found in baking soda, they regulate the pH of food, preventing it from becoming too acidic or too alkaline. In the culinary world, sodium carbonates can also enhance the texture and structure of foods, such as noodles, by modifying the gluten network.

    Generally recognized as safe, sodium carbonates are non-toxic when consumed in typical amounts found in food.

  • E520 - Aluminium sulphate


    Aluminium sulfate: Aluminium sulfate is a chemical compound with the formula Al2-SO4-3. It is soluble in water and is mainly used as a coagulating agent -promoting particle collision by neutralizing charge- in the purification of drinking water and waste water treatment plants, and also in paper manufacturing. The anhydrous form occurs naturally as a rare mineral millosevichite, found e.g. in volcanic environments and on burning coal-mining waste dumps. Aluminium sulfate is rarely, if ever, encountered as the anhydrous salt. It forms a number of different hydrates, of which the hexadecahydrate Al2-SO4-3•16H2O and octadecahydrate Al2-SO4-3•18H2O are the most common. The heptadecahydrate, whose formula can be written as [Al-H2O-6]2-SO4-3•5H2O, occurs naturally as the mineral alunogen. Aluminium sulfate is sometimes called alum or papermaker's alum in certain industries. However, the name "alum" is more commonly and properly used for any double sulfate salt with the generic formula XAl-SO4-2·12H2O, where X is a monovalent cation such as potassium or ammonium.

  • E541 - Sodium aluminium phosphate


    Sodium aluminium phosphate: Sodium aluminium phosphate -SAlP- describes the inorganic compounds consisting of sodium salts of aluminium phosphates. The most common SAlP has the formulas NaH14Al3-PO4-8·4H2O and Na3H15Al2-PO4-8. These materials are prepared by combining alumina, phosphoric acid, and sodium hydroxide.In addition to the usual hydrate, an anhydrous SAlP is also known, Na3H15Al2-PO4-8 -CAS#10279-59-1-, referred to as 8:2:3, reflecting the ratio of phosphate to aluminium to sodium. Additionally an SAlP of ill-defined stoichiometry is used -NaxAly-PO4-z -CAS# 7785-88-8-.The acidic sodium aluminium phosphates are used as acids for baking powders for the chemical leavening of baked goods. Upon heating, SAlP combines with the baking soda to give carbon dioxide. Most of its action occurs at baking temperatures, rather than when the dough or batter is mixed at room temperature. SAlPs are advantageous because they impart a neutral flavor. As a food additive, it has the E number E541. Basic sodium aluminium phosphates are also known, e.g., Na15Al3-PO4-8. These species are useful in cheese making.

  • E621 - Monosodium glutamate


    Monosodium glutamate: Monosodium glutamate -MSG, also known as sodium glutamate- is the sodium salt of glutamic acid, one of the most abundant naturally occurring non-essential amino acids. Glutamic acid is found naturally in tomatoes, grapes, cheese, mushrooms and other foods.MSG is used in the food industry as a flavor enhancer with an umami taste that intensifies the meaty, savory flavor of food, as naturally occurring glutamate does in foods such as stews and meat soups. It was first prepared in 1908 by Japanese biochemist Kikunae Ikeda, who was trying to isolate and duplicate the savory taste of kombu, an edible seaweed used as a base for many Japanese soups. MSG as a flavor enhancer balances, blends, and rounds the perception of other tastes.The U.S. Food and Drug Administration has given MSG its generally recognized as safe -GRAS- designation. A popular belief is that large doses of MSG can cause headaches and other feelings of discomfort, known as "Chinese restaurant syndrome," but double-blind tests fail to find evidence of such a reaction. The European Union classifies it as a food additive permitted in certain foods and subject to quantitative limits. MSG has the HS code 29224220 and the E number E621.
